About

Overland Park is a city located in the county of Johnson in the U.S. state of Kansas. Its population at the 2010 census was 173,372 and a population density of 885 people per km². After 10 years in 2020 city had an estimated population of 197,381 inhabitants.

The city was created 119 years ago in 1904.

Job Opportunities

Overland Park serves as a major employment hub with corporate headquarters and regional offices. Major companies like Black & Veatch, Compass Minerals and Farmers Insurance base operations here. The city's population booms during weekdays as over 150,000 commuters come for work.

The economy also benefits from healthcare services centered around Overland Park Regional Medical Center. Retail jobs can be found in developments like the Oak Park Mall, which generates over $600 million in annual sales.

Outdoor Recreation

Overland Park lives up to its name with over 1,800 acres of public parkland and 85 miles of biking and hiking trails. The Tallgrass Prairie National Preserve offers hiking among rare tallgrass prairie ecosystems.

At the Overland Park Arboretum & Botanical Gardens, visitors enjoy 10 themed gardens showcasing flowers, herbs and ornamental grasses. The city also manages an impressive public golf course network with four 18-hole regulation courses.

Family Fun

Top attractions like the KC T-Bones Stadium, Deanna Rose Children’s Farmstead, and Museum at Prairiefire provide entertainment for all ages. Downtown Overland Park features farmer’s markets, public art, and summer concerts in quaint settings.

The city boasts a Blue Ribbon School system and amenities like the Overland Park Convention Center that enhance the community's draw for families.
